A Medical Examiner Investigator (Investigator II, non-post) is responsible for providing scene and telephonic response to deaths reported to the OME. The Investigations section is responsible for the investigation of all deaths falling under the jurisdiction of the Office of the Medical Examiner as stated in Utah Code 26B-8-205, including initial scene response, coordinating transportation of decedents, processing evidence, identifying decedents, and following up on investigations to aid in the determination of the cause and manner of death. Key Responsibilities Handling phone calls reporting deaths, responding to death scenes, conducting investigations which include researching and gathering information, interviewing witnesses, real time database direct entry, preparing investigative reports, handling evidence, moving remains, and determining jurisdiction of deaths reported to the OME. Assisting medical examiners/forensic pathologists with completing documentation of evidence collected and recorded chain of custody, reports, and records gathering and review, and other requests as needed. Is familiar with laws and regulations regarding death investigation in Utah. Responding to incoming questions and complaints, providing information as allowed by law, explaining policies and procedures, and facilitating resolution of issues as they arise. Facilitating information exchange between investigators and organ and tissue donation coordinators to allow for timely donation of organs and tissues. Coordinating information exchanges with law enforcement entities, treating physicians, attorneys and families. Other duties, tasks, and responsibilities may be assigned at any time. The Office of the Medical Examiner (OME) was established in 1972 and is a part of the Utah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S). We investigate all sudden, unexpected, violent, suspicious, or unattended deaths in Utah. For more information about the OME, click here .
